Hello everyone I just got a baby bearded dragon and boy is it tiny! It actually scares me how small and young he is! I hope I do everything right because it’s kinda worrisome wondering if this or that is correct! I have a 40 gal breeder but was told he’d starve to death in it to I have a 29 gallon I believe it is and put him/her in that! I have a dual dome and in it is a coil bulb 10.0 uvb bulb and a 75watt basking bulb which I removed the 75 watt and put a 100watt diff brand bulb in. I also have a 100watt heat emitter going as well because I felt the temps were just not hot enough!?! So now I have to have all three going, and then at night I plug in a little ceramic heater in the outlet near his cage to keep the ambient temp
In the room warm but this morning he was pretty dark in color when I turned on his lights, boy does he sleep hard as a rock! Lol So on Thursday I am going to buy a long reptisun aquarium hood and uvb bulb instead of this cool one because I heard they’re better and I was going to place it on top of
My metal screen on top of tank, not inside, I don’t now how to do that? Now on to feeding, ive been offering meals a couple times a day but the little guy only eats one big meal a day or several small ones. I got him from petco by the way. First of all all they had were crickets and mealworms I bought some of both but now regret it. I have a container in my fridge of mealworms which I’m not
Gonna feed him so if anyone wants them let me know lol! He ate crickets the night I brought him home (7 total) and then the next day he ate ten crickets and then wouldn’t eat anymore that day, then the next day I put him in a little container I have and put ten roaches in and he ate them all so I added more but he was done, then later that day I tried the same thing and he wouldn’t eat them just kept trying to escape the container. Yesterday morning I tried the same bing and the same result just kept ignoring the roaches and trying to escape, so o put him back in his tank and decided to add crickets and try that again. He ate them up! I’d add three at a time and he would eat them, so yesterday he had a total of one roach and about ten crickets I’d say? I had to keep taking the little guy down from his perch for him to eat tho, he would eat one hen jump back up on his perch so I’d take him down and then he’d eat one jump back up and so on and so forth! He’s been having a nice poop once or twice a day everyday! He seems like a good little guy! The only concern I have is yesterday he was basking up on the highest point of his perch and temps were good but there was a moment when it looked like his eyeballs were popping out a little and all you could see in his eyes were a pink or red, and he shuddered a little, his head but it was only a split second and then his eyes rolled back, so idk what it was and it’s kinda concerning but it was that once and for a quick second.
